1991 Honda Concerto vs. 1998 Kia Potentia

To start off, 1998 Kia Potentia is newer by 7 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1991 Honda Concerto.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1991 Honda Concerto would be higher. At 1,998 cc (4 cylinders), 1998 Kia Potentia is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1998 Kia Potentia (138 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 49 more horse power than 1991 Honda Concerto. (89 HP @ 6000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1998 Kia Potentia should accelerate faster than 1991 Honda Concerto.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1998 Kia Potentia weights approximately 430 kg more than 1991 Honda Concerto.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1998 Kia Potentia is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1998 Kia Potentia.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1991 Honda Concerto,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1998 Kia Potentia (181 Nm) has 62 more torque (in Nm) than 1991 Honda Concerto. (119 Nm). This means 1998 Kia Potentia will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1991 Honda Concerto.

Compare all specifications:

1991 Honda Concerto 1998 Kia Potentia
Make Honda Kia
Model Concerto Potentia
Year Released 1991 1998
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1493 cc 1998 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 89 HP 138 HP
Engine RPM 6000 RPM 6000 RPM
Torque 119 Nm 181 Nm
Engine Bore Size 75 mm 85.1 mm
Engine Stroke Size 84.5 mm 87.9 mm
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Front Rear
Number of Seats 5 seats 4 seats
Vehicle Weight 1035 kg 1465 kg
Vehicle Length 4270 mm 4960 mm
Vehicle Width 1700 mm 1730 mm
Vehicle Height 1400 mm 1440 mm
Wheelbase Size 2560 mm 2720 mm
